提供載入和預覽 AnimationClips 的功能。它包含一些有用的功能,例如 Animation 。
Class.AnimationClipProvider 替換了使用過時的 KeyframeSequenceProvider 來下載內容 ID 的 KeyframeSequences。
動畫片提供商有一些使用。
- 從 Roblox 網站下載與動畫內容 ID 相關的 AnimationClip,無論是否為基礎類型的 AnimationClip ( KeyframeSequence 或 2>Class.CurveAnimation2> ) 。
- 生成暫時 ID 預覽動畫。
- 取得特定使用者擁有的動畫的內容ID。
概要
方法
從 AnimationClip 生成暫時資產 ID,可用於本地測試動畫。
從 AnimationClip 生成暫時資產 ID,可用於本地測試動畫。生成哈希。
以 AnimationClip 的資產ID 來同步指定的資產。
此功能返回 InventoryPages 個對象,可以用來重複擁有特定用戶的動畫。
屬性
方法
RegisterActiveAnimationClip
生成一個暫時的資產ID來從 AnimationClip 中,可以用於測試動畫的本地化測試。這個ID 的作用與 RegisterAnimationClip() 的ID 相同,但生成的ID 會而不是哈希。生成的ID 可以用作測試的 Class.Animation
這個函數生成的資產 ID 是暫時的,不能在 Studio 外部使用。開發人員希望生成可以在線上使用的資產 ID 時,應該上傳 AnimationClip 到 Roblox。
參數
要使用的 AnimationClip。
返回
一個暫時的資產 ID 用於本地化動畫播放。
RegisterAnimationClip
從 AnimationClip 生成暫時資產 ID,可用於本地測試動畫。
此功能執行相同的功能至 RegisterActiveAnimationClip ,但生成一個 啟用:// 的網址,而不是哈希。
產生的 ID 可用於測試動畫的 Animation.AnimationId 屬性。
這個函數生成的資產 ID 是暫時的,不能在 Studio 外部使用。開發人員希望生成可以在線上使用的資產 ID 時,應該上傳 AnimationClip 到 Roblox。
參數
要使用的 AnimationClip。
返回
一個暫時的資產 ID 用於本地化動畫播放。
GetAnimationClipAsync
擷取指定資產ID 的 AnimationClip。資產ID 必須與 Roblox 中的動畫資產對應。 函數將在 AnimationClip 從網站載入後產生,並包含在 pcall 中。
參數
動畫的內容ID。
返回
GetAnimations
此功能返回 InventoryPages 個對象,可以用來重複擁有特定用戶的動畫。
這個功能有一些潛在的使用,例如允許用戶瀏覽並匯入動畫到自訂動畫外掛程式。
參數
使用者的ID。
返回
一個 InventoryPages 的動畫。